Articles
Register
Sign In
Search
maumaubrasil
Ambicioso
0
Followers
40
Questões
14
Respostas
maumaubrasil
July 2023 | 1 Respostas
A arquitetura Web apresenta diferentes modelos. Cada um deles reúne características que os definem e os diferenciam entre si, trabalhando componentes de sistemas de formas distintas. Os dois modelos que representam o atual cenário de aplicações Web são: monolítico e microsserviços. Dadas as características em comum entre eles, todos parecem ter uma mesma base, mesmo com suas distinções. Assinale a afirmativa correta quanto às características presentes nos modelos: A. Todos os modelos de arquitetura utilizam o acesso aos dados por ambiente Web usando protocolos de rede da Internet como HTTP, FTP, URL e SMTP. B. Os modelos monolíticos não trabalham em três camadas pelo fato de serem baseados em serviços independentes uns dos outros, que se comunicam por meio de APIs, apenas. C. Os modelos monolítico e microsserviços utilizam duas camadas como forma de acesso aos servidores: camada de apresentação e camada de dados.. D; Os modelos de arquitetura Web utilizam protocolos como HTML e CSS como forma de comunicação de dados através das camadas da Internet. E. Os dois modelos têm várias características em comum, principalmente o fato de utilizarem recursos como APIs e serviços separados dentro dos servidores de dados.
Responda
maumaubrasil
July 2023 | 2 Respostas
O Django é um poderoso framework desenvolvido em Python que provê diversos mecanismos para desenvolvimento de aplicações web completas de forma rápida e com qualidade. Acerca das definições do Django, assinale a alternativa correta. A. O Django é a forma de desenvolvimento web para desenvolvedores que utilizam Python. B. O Django é um framework Python exclusivo para desenvolvimento de aplicações web. C. O Django permite facilitar o desenvolvimento implementando mecanismos que tratam requisições. D. Uma questão a se preocupar quanto à utilização do Django é com relação a escalabilidade. E. Mecanismos de segurança como Cross site scripting (XSS) e Cross site request forgery (CSRF) não são suportados.
Responda
maumaubrasil
July 2023 | 1 Respostas
A instalação do Django é bem simples, mas alguns passos devem ser executados; o esquecimento de alguns itens pode ocasionar problemas que, a princípio, podem se tornar um transtorno. Imagine que, após a instalação do Django, o seguinte erro está sendo apresentado: bash: command not found Assinale a alternativa que apresenta a possível causa desse problema. A. Provavelmente existe um problema decorrente da instalação do Python na máquina. B. A instalação do Django framework possivelmente está corrompida ou com problema. C. Existe possivelmente uma incompatibilidade entre a versão de instalação do Django e o Python. D. A configuração do database do Django framework está possivelmente com problema. E. A instalação do Django framework está correta e essa é a mensagem padrão a ser exibida.
Responda
maumaubrasil
July 2023 | 1 Respostas
A Model View Template (MVT) é um padrão de arquitetura em que os projetos são subdivididos em Model, que é a camada de acesso à base de dados, Template, que é a camada de visualização das informações, e View, responsável pelas regras de negócios do sistema Django. Analisando a arquitetura MVT do Django, com enfoque para a camada Model, assinale a alternativa correta. A. É nessa camada que são realizados os roteamentos de URLs. B. É considerada a camada intermediária da arquitetura do Django. C. É a camada de interação do usuário com o website. D. É a camada onde estão as entidades do sistema. E. Essa camada não tem interação com o banco de dados.
Responda
maumaubrasil
July 2023 | 1 Respostas
O mecanismo de modelo do Django fornece uma minilinguagem poderosa para definir a camada voltada para o usuário do aplicativo, incentivando uma separação limpa da lógica do aplicativo e da apresentação. A DTL (Django Template Language) é a linguagem padrão de templates do Django. Assinale a alternativa correta acerca da DTL. A. Deve conter a lógica de negócios em código Python. B. Usada para criar arquivos de templates a serem utilizados. C. Localizada na camada intermediária da arquitetura do Django. D. Permite a inserção de código diretamente no arquivo HTML. E. É um pacote separado do framework, por ser uma linguagem.
Responda
maumaubrasil
July 2023 | 1 Respostas
Visual Studio é um IDE para desenvolvimento de software com muitas funcionalidades, dispondo de diversas versões para atender a diversos públicos, desde versões livres até versões pagas. Indique qual opção representa a versão paga do Visual Studio desenvolvida para grandes empresas com equipes de desenvolvimento numerosas. A. Community. B. Enterprise. C. Django. D. Python. E. Professional.
Responda
maumaubrasil
July 2023 | 1 Respostas
Python é uma linguagem de programação multiparadigma conhecida por ser de fácil aprendizagem, além de ser executada em diversas plataformas. Uma delas é a plataforma Windows, na qual ela pode ser facilmente integrada ao IDE Visual Studio. Indique qual opção representa a forma mais simplória de verificar se Python está corretamente integrado ao Visual Studio. A. Criar um novo projeto Python e executar. B. Verificar se Python está instalado nas extensões do IDE. C. Executar um simples comando no “Python interativo”. D. Verificar se Python está disponível para instalação. E. Verificar se os diretórios da instalação estão presentes.
Responda
maumaubrasil
July 2023 | 1 Respostas
Um projeto Django é composto por diversos arquivos com extensão ".py", uma vez que a linguagem de programação utilizada pelo framework é Python. Indique qual arquivo tem a funcionalidade de armazenar, em formato de índice, as páginas do projeto. A. “__init__.py”. B. wsgi.py. C. settings.py. D. test.py. E. urls.py.
Responda
maumaubrasil
July 2023 | 1 Respostas
Ao iniciar um projeto Django no Visual Studio, diversos erros podem ocorrer. Um deles é que o projeto pode não ter um arquivo definido para que o projeto inicialize suas funcionalidades por meio dele, ou seja, uma espécie de arquivo inicial que inicializa todo o projeto. Indique qual seria o correto procedimento para solucionar essa dificuldade. A. debug(depurar)>start debugging e iniciar o teste do aplicativo. B. Project>Propities e definir o Working Directory. C. arquivo>novo>projeto e criar um arquivo de inicialização. D. Project>Propities e definir o Startup File. E. Project>Propities e definir o Interpretador.
Responda
maumaubrasil
July 2023 | 1 Respostas
Um projeto de aplicativo web, tendo como base o framework Django, em conjunto com a linguagem de programação Python, tem diversos recursos incorporados que visam a ajudar a desenvolver aplicações de forma rápida e eficaz. Dentre os recursos disponíveis em um projeto do tipo, indique a estrutura que provê a possibilidade de criar formulários automaticamente com base no banco de dados da aplicação. A. Migrations. B. Admin.py. C. Templates. D. App.py. E. Models.py.
Responda
maumaubrasil
July 2023 | 1 Respostas
O Django é um framework Python de alto nível, que incentiva o desenvolvimento coeso de aplicações Web por meio da própria linguagem Python. É responsável pela parte do desenvolvimento Web, como tratamento de requisições, mapeamento objeto-relacional, entre outros. Sendo assim, é correto afirmar que o Django é um framework de arquitetura: A. MVC (Model-View-Controller). B. MCT (Model-Controller-Transfer). C. MTV (Model-Template-View). D. MTA (Model-Transfer-Abstract). E. MVT (Model-View-Trought).
Responda
maumaubrasil
July 2023 | 1 Respostas
A maior vantagem do Django está diretamente ligada às suas facilidades, isto é, à sua conceituação arquitetural em três camadas. A camada de Modelos tem uma função essencial na arquitetura das aplicações desenvolvidas com o Django, pois é nela que se descreve(m): A. os campos e os comportamentos das entidades que não irão compor o sistema, e a lógica de acesso aos dados da aplicação. B. os comportamentos das entidades que irão compor o sistema, unicamente. C. a lógica de acesso aos dados da aplicação, unicamente. D. a lógica de acesso aos dados da aplicação e os campos e comportamentos das entidades que irão compor o sistema. E. o template da lógica de acesso e os comportamentos das entidades externas ao sistema.
Responda
maumaubrasil
July 2023 | 1 Respostas
No Django, uma View é uma forma de processar os dados de uma URL específica, pois ela descreve qual informação é apresentada, por meio do processamento descrito pelo desenvolvedor em seu código. Além disso, é imprescindível separar conteúdo de: A. apresentação. B. negócio. C. abstração. D. gestão. E. orquestração.
Responda
maumaubrasil
July 2023 | 1 Respostas
Um modelo é a descrição do dado que será gerenciado pela sua aplicação Django e contém os campos e comportamentos desses dados. No fim, cada modelo vai equivaler a uma tabela no banco de dados. No Django, um modelo tem basicamente duas características, que são: A. o fato de cada atributo representar um campo da tabela e de ser uma classe que herda de django.db.models.View. B. o fato de cada atributo representar um campo da tabela e de ser uma classe que herda de django.db.models.Template. C. o fato de cada atributo representar um campo da tabela e de ser uma classe que herda de django.db.views.Model. D. o fato de cada atributo representar um campo da tabela e de ser uma classe que herda de django.db.template.Model. E. o fato de cada atributo representar um campo da tabela e de ser uma classe que herda de django.db.models.Model. 4 de 5 perguntas
Responda
maumaubrasil
July 2023 | 1 Respostas
Entre as finalidades do painel de administração do Django, tem-se a administração dos dados na arquitetura MTV, seu fluxo de vida e, principalmente: A. a criação de novos usuários comuns e grupos de usuários. B. a criação de novas classes e métodos. C. a criação de novos atores e relacionamentos. D. a criação de novas instâncias. E. a criação de novos parâmetros.
Responda
maumaubrasil
July 2023 | 1 Respostas
Com o MySQL Workbench é possível visualizar os registros de uma tabela por meio de uma grade que apresenta o resultado de uma instrução SELECT. Ao editar o valor de um campo diretamente nessa grade, o registro: A. será alterado automaticamente no banco de dados. B. será alterado no banco de dados após clicar no botão Commit. C. será alterado no banco de dados após clicar no botão Apply. D. não será alterado no banco de dados, apenas na visualização da grade. E. não pode ser alterado pela grade de visualização de uma consulta.
Responda
maumaubrasil
July 2023 | 1 Respostas
Existem comandos que automatizam parte do processo de criação dos modelos na forma de comandos SQL, em um arquivo para cada versão e aplicação das alterações deste no banco de dados. Marque o comando que cria o arquivo com as alterações das classes modelo na forma de comandos SQL. A. python manage.py makemigrations. B. python manage.py migrate. C. python makemigrations manage.py. D. python migrate manage.py. E. python manage.py runserver.
Responda
maumaubrasil
July 2023 | 1 Respostas
O Django utiliza o conceito de ORM (object relational mapper), ou mapeador de objeto relacional, que abstrai a criação das tabelas do banco a partir dos atributos descritos nas classes modelo. Qual o nome do arquivo no qual são descritas as classes utilizadas para a geração das tabelas do banco de dados? A. urls.py. B. views.py. C. templates.py. D. models.py. E. settings.py.
Responda
maumaubrasil
July 2023 | 1 Respostas
Com o Django é possível configurar diferentes tipos de banco de dados para armazenar os dados das aplicações, inclusive com controle de múltiplos bancos simultaneamente. Marque a opção que representa a chave que deve receber como dicionário os parâmetros do banco de dados que será o banco padrão da aplicação. A. ‘name’. B. ‘engine’. C. ‘default’. D. ‘host’. E. ‘port'.
Responda
maumaubrasil
July 2023 | 1 Respostas
O SGBD padrão do Django é o SQLite, que pode ser substituído pelo PostgreSQL ou pelo MySQL, entre outros bancos. Marque a opção que representa o valor que deve ser configurado na chave ‘ENGINE’ do arquivo settings.py para configurar o banco a fim de utilizar o MySQL. A. 'db.backends.django.mysql'. B. 'django.db.settings.mysql'. C. 'db.django.backends.mysql'. D. 'django.db.backends.oracle'. E. 'django.db.backends.mysql'.
Responda
maumaubrasil
July 2023 | 1 Respostas
No Django, para que seja possível importar arquivos estáticos em uma página Web, é necessário seguir algumas recomendações e padrões. Marque a opção que representa o trecho de código que precisa ser adicionado no começo do documento HTML para que seja possível carregar documentos estáticos com o Django. A. {% load static %}. B. {% load_static %}. C. {% static_files %}. D. {% load files %}. E. {% static load %}.
Responda
maumaubrasil
July 2023 | 1 Respostas
Com a camada view do Django, é possível fazer o controle das rotas do aplicativo e redirecionar o usuário para outras telas. Marque a opção que representa o trecho de código a ser adicionado no atributo href de uma tag de link em um código HTML. A. {% route ‘nome_rota’ %}. B. {% url ‘nome_rota’ %}. C. {% path ‘nome_rota’ %}. D. {$ path ‘nome_rota’ $}. E. {$ url ‘nome_rota’ $}.
Responda
maumaubrasil
July 2023 | 1 Respostas
Com o framework Django, é possível criar formulários de forma automatizada. Marque a opção que representa a camada em que são descritos os componentes do formulário, os quais são a base para a criação automática do formulário. A. Front end. B. View. C. Template. D. Model. E. Middleware.
Responda
maumaubrasil
July 2023 | 1 Respostas
Quando o usuário interage com um formulário criado de maneira automatizada pelo Django, objetos do tipo formulário de um modelo são instanciados. Marque a opção que representa a classe padrão para criação das classes e que usa o modelo para salvar o resultado do formulário: A. ObjectModel. B. FormModel. C. ModelForm. D. ModelMeta. E. MetaForm.
Responda
1
2
»
Helpful Links
Sobre nós
Política de Privacidade
Termos e Condições
direito autoral
Contate-Nos
Helpful Social
Get monthly updates
Submit
Copyright © 2024 ELIBRARY.TIPS - All rights reserved.